From f3dbec60f2a2f0838b8cf110b6975e842a8763ec Mon Sep 17 00:00:00 2001 From: Donald Sharp Date: Thu, 19 Sep 2019 16:05:39 -0400 Subject: [PATCH] zebra: Send RTPROT_ZEBRA for netlink messages missing this data Update neighbor entries and rule entries to have the RTPROT_ZEBRA protocol value. So we can tell where things come from.
